Job Title: Accounts Assistant
Contract type: Fixed term contract for up to 6 months, could lead to a permanent position.
Hours: 37.5 hours per week, Monday - Friday 9am - 5pm
Location: Hybrid working, 4 days remote working, 1 day per week working at our Head office in Cannock
Salary: £28,000 - £30,000 depending on skills and experience

What you'll get to do:
Accounts Receivable Duties:
- Ledger ownership and maintenance
- Proactive credit control via email and telephone
- Daily Cash allocation
- Resolving queries
- Issuing Credit notes and Invoices
- Updating Group cash flow spreadsheet
Accounts Payable Duties:
- Processing supplier invoices (approx. 500 per month)
- Dealing with and resolving account queries
- Processing weekly payment runs
- Supplier account reconciliations
- Ledger ownership and maintenance
What we're looking for from you:
- Good knowledge of Microsoft Excel, including v-look up and pivot table standard
- Minimum 12 months experience as an accounts assistant
- Knowledge of SAGE Intacct preferred
